Aniline Degradation via 2‐Aminophenol: Genetic Basis, Broadened Players and Interspecies CooperationNARA Subscribed
For more than four decades, the catechol route has been the only genetically resolved aerobic pathway for aniline biodegradation. The genetic basis of aniline degradation via 2‐aminophenol is relatively unexplored. In this study, Pseudomonas sp.
